I am a parent with one child having graduated from SHS and now a freshman there. The principal seems very involved. The teachers are mostly awesome, with a few exceptions. The sports programs receive a ton of community support and there is a lot of parent involvement. You can really tell that parents in the area care. In the five years we have been in Sandpoint we have not personally been involved with any negative issues with safety or discipline. My only negative comment might be that the counselors should do a better job of preparing the students for college. I realize the parents need to take the initiative here. If the parents do take the initiative I'm sure the students will be fine.

SHS is a school trying to clean up its act. It still has a long way to go and often times I do not agree with the adminstration's policies. Some teachers are well qualified, but too many are still employed and need to be given the boot or greater accountability. Some spend too much time trying to handhold those who have no amibition to better themselves after high school, and in doing so, they bring the quality of the class way down. The low budget school system lacks the ability to properly educate kids at either end. Advanced and basic classes are often cut due to budget constraints. Be warned that tax payers in Sandpoint are not generous!!
